i’ve gotten advice from my breeder, and read the book “leaf-tailed geckos - the complete uroplatus” by philip-sebastian gehring (2020), so that’s what i’ve been basing my care on. for my hatchling i keep the humidity a big higher to prevent shedding issues, but for my adults i mist them once every evening, which keeps the humidity at around 80% during the night, and let it dry out a bit during the day. the temp is around 20c during night time, and slightly higher during the day. i make sure to keep their room cool during summer to prevent any temps above 26c. however, it’s not abnormal for reptiles to take a while to adjust to their new surroundings before they feel comfortable enough to eat, so as long as your temperature and humidity isn’t way off i wouldn’t worry too much yet :-)

Help with knob tail handling by TechicalGuide604 in geckos

[–]JinxIsMyGf 3 points4 points  (0 children)

if you have a small plastic container or something like that, you can try scooping him up in it and move him that way. use a lid or your hand to cover the top of the container so he doesn’t get skittish and try to jump out
